Handover: Brell → Tavik. The flaky DNS resolution on the Norvane edge cluster traces to a stale resolver cache in quorum node 3. Mitigation script is in the runbook; restart order matters. Security note: the resolver vault reseals after restart. The recovery passphrase to unseal it follows below.

vault phrase of tajop-haduf = holath-brivan-wenax

**Ticket: Telemetry compression settings drifted from baseline**

Support team, heads up: the Lanternwick telemetry agents in the Fernwood cluster are sending uncompressed payloads again, which explains the bandwidth alerts customers have been reporting. The compression flags were overridden during an incident in March and never reverted, so the fleet has drifted from the approved baseline. For reference when handling related cases, the intended configuration values are below.

config for kafof-bawef:
holath:
  log_level: debug
  metrics_host: metrics.holath.qorvelsys.internal
  pin: 2191
  pool_size: 32

10:05 — The Marrowgate catalogue import finally kicked off after the schema cache warmed up. Heads up, plugin folks: records with missing shelf codes got quarantined instead of dropped, so your hooks will see them on retry. About 2,300 titles landed cleanly in the first batch. If you're debugging hook behavior, match your logs against the import build noted below.

pipeline stamp: htk31_f769b577b3028a4e9958e5bb8d1259a

- [ ] Step 7: Archive cold storage buckets (Glacierline tier). Confirm both ceremony witnesses are present, verify bucket manifests match the Oxbow ledger, then seal the archive key shares. Plugin authors may observe but not handle shares. Once sealed, the archive index itself is encrypted and can only be reopened with the passphrase below.

vault phrase of badup-hahig = tamael-aldael-kelmir-istael-fenok-istwyn-tamius-jorath-oliion

Handover from Marisol to the incoming folks on Pondglass: we now gzip telemetry payloads above 4 KB before they hit the Larkspur collector, which cut bandwidth roughly 60%. Watch CPU on the edge agents — compression is tunable per tier. The thresholds and codec choices live in the agent config, reproduced in full here.

config for bahop-fajep:
DRUATH_PIN=4501
DRUATH_TENANT=briwyn
DRUATH_METRICS_HOST=metrics.druath.brasksoft.test
DRUATH_SEAL=seal_7d2e069d
DRUATH_STANDBY_TEAM=olieth